There are no rules. You can write a story, if you wish, with no conflict, no suspense, no beginning, middle or end. Of course, you have to be regarded as a genius to get away with it, and that's the hardest part - convincing everybody you're a genius.
-
The shortest horror story: The last man on Earth sat alone in a room. There was a knock on the door.
-
Don't ever sell mankind short by saying there's anything they can't do.
-
When you look out of a window, when you look at anything, you know what you're seeing? Yourself. A thing can only look beautiful or romantic or inspiring only if the beauty or romance or inspiration is inside you.
-
No one can tell time except approximately, time never stands still to be named.
